Zusammenfassung:The embodiment of the utility model discloses a wind tunnel structure for a heat dissipation performance test. The wind tunnel structure comprises a shell and a mounting panel, and the shell comprises an internal containing cavity, an air inlet and an air outlet so as to form a through-flow air channel simulating heat dissipation airflow; the installation panel is detachably arranged on one side of the air inlet of the shell, and the installation panel is provided with a through-flow hole and an installation interface which are respectively matched with a power device to be tested. Based on the characteristic that the mounting panel is detachably connected with the shell, the mounting panel corresponding to the to-be-tested power device can be selectively configured. Through the structural design of replacing the mounting panel, the scheme can be applied to heat dissipation performance tests of power devices of different models or specifications.
